The Royal Military College (RMC), founded in 1801 and established in 1802 at Great Marlow and High Wycombe in Buckinghamshire, England, but moved in October 1812 to Sandhurst, Berkshire, was a British Army military academy for training infantry and cavalry officers of the British and Indian Armies.

Royal Military Academy may refer to: Royal Military Academy, Woolwich, a British Army academy established in 1741 and closed in 1939; Royal Military Academy Sandhurst, a British Army academy established in 1947; Royal Military Academy (Belgium), the military university of Belgium; Meknes Royal Military Academy, Morocco
